About Etched Monstrosity
Etched Monstrosity, Artifact creature — phyrexian golem, designed by Steven Belledin first released in May, 2011 in the set New Phyrexia and was printed exactly in 2 different ways.
This card could be beneficial in a control deck that focuses on card advantage and resource manipulation, as it provides a way to draw three cards at the cost of removing -1/-1 counters. However, there are likely better options for card draw in most decks, such as Sphinx's Revelation or Fact or Fiction, which offer more immediate and versatile benefits without the need for -1/-1 counters. Etched Monstrosity may not see much play in competitive decks due to its high cost and conditional card draw ability.

What is the effect of Etched Monstrosity?
Etched Monstrosity enters the battlefield with five -1/-1 counters on it. {W}{U}{B}{R}{G}, Remove five -1/-1 counters from Etched Monstrosity: Target player draws three cards.
What is the original set of Etched Monstrosity?
Etched Monstrosity was first released in the set New Phyrexia, illustrated by Steven Belledin.
